      @Suzaku_Mizutani 7 лет назад +2

      I quite like that idea, the repairing weapons thing. It was in my second favorite FE game, FE4 as a system where at your home castle/taken castles, you can go to a shop and get it repaired for a fee. It adds a neat little effect where you're going to have them repair their weapon and not just throw it away. Maybe also a penalty for this is the broken weapon mechanic in FE4 where if a weapon breaks, it will be become "Broken weapon". This broken weapon is extremely heavy, has shit hit, and no strength, so it makes you watch your weapons and to swap it around.
      My honest hopes for FE16 is the repair/broken weapon system from FE4, the pair-up, and one of either the CON system or St.- weapon Weight=speed loss (only if number is negative). IDK.

  • @scarlett285
    @scarlett285 8 лет назад +195

    I can disagree with the weapon statement. I liked what they did with weapons because it added a layer of depth to what weapons you would give to who. You wouldn't give a steal weapon to a fast user but an iron. And if you need the weaker weapons stronger you can power them up.

    • @scarlett285
      @scarlett285 8 лет назад +14

      They did make silver weapons to weak though.

    • @Syrahl696
      @Syrahl696 8 лет назад +27

      I really liked that change because it turned what was previously a bookkeeping decision into a tactical decision.
      In previous games, your characters would hold onto multiple weapons, in case one breaks. And you would willfully choose to use a worse weapon over better ones because you needed to keep the better weapons in good condition to use against tougher enemies later. It wasn't a broken system, or even a bad one by any means, but that was how it was.
      In Fates, your characters would hold onto multiple weapons because even in the same category of weapons (say, lances) no one weapon is hands down the best for every situation. You would willfully choose to use a weaker weapon over a strong one because you can better handle it's downsides. I feel like those decisions were a lot more fun to make than decisions about weapon durability.
      The relationship between Iron and Steel weapons is reminiscent of the weapon weight system in the GBA games, where a heavier (higher tier) weapon would slow you down if you were too weak for it. I feel like one possible reason this system was scrapped in Awakening was because it was not transparent and obvious enough, and I like that they brought back the spirit of it for Fates, while presenting it in a better place.

      @TheEeveeKing 5 лет назад

      Actually, I'd like to say that with the exception of the S axe and *S*taff, the S rank weapons generally rank rather highly in terms of physical power.
      Hagakure blade gives 20 Avoid, and has +15 Damage over the Sunrise Katana. You'd have to have 32 STR to have that difference be noticable, and that's only 1 in every 2 turns.
      Waterwheel is a similar case, and though you'd lose Damage over all, you'd get +10 Avoid, +20 Crit Avoid, and +10 Hit. Really, this one's advantages are strong.
      Pursuer loses defense and res, as well as avoid, but comes with a STAGGERING 22 might, +5 AS, and +10 crit. Your opponent also gets +5 AS, but you shouldn't be using this against units that are faster then you anyways.
      Characharm is well....+7 AS and +5 AS, and cripples your defenses by 5 each, though decreases STR, MAG, DEF, and RES by 6 for debuffs.
      Exaclibur has...+5/+5 for AS for both sides, Effectiveness against all fliers, AND 25% crit. it SHREDS fliers with 36 might.
      These are all excellent weapons in their own ways.
